ZAMBOANGA CITY (MindaNews / 23 July) – The Office of the City Agriculturist has apprehended 20 unregistered motorized bancas since January in its intensified campaign against “colorum” watercrafts.
City agriculturist Diosdado Palacat said Wednesday they intensified the campaign since 800 owners of the 2,800 registered motorized bancas did not renew their registration this year despite coordination and advice from barangay officials.
He said majority of the apprehended motorized bancas are from Barangays Curuan and Buenavista of this city.
Palacat said the owners of the apprehended unregistered motorized bancas were slapped with P1,000 fine and were required to pay the P600 registration fee per unit. Renewal of registration, on the other hand, is at P400 per unit.
He said the registration of motorized bancas is pursuant to an existing city ordinance that requires owners of watercrafts three tons and below to register with the city government.
The color or color combination of registered motorized bancas from one barangay varies from that of other villages and with corresponding code number.
Palacat said the mandatory registration of motorized bancas is part of this city’s security measures since it would be easy for lawmen to identify small watercrafts if they are from this city or not.
He said the registration of motorized bancas is also a big help in the campaign against illegal fishing since it would be easy to trace ownership for those who manage to evade arrest at sea.
